Lotto NZ is dropping a massive ten million dollar jackpot this weekend — the final draw with the old ten-ball setup before a major game overhaul next week. With a new fourteen-ball format, an added Powerball Division Eight, and jackpots soaring up to sixty million, it’s your last chance to win big before the rules change. Tickets stay the same price, but the stakes are higher than ever — and if no one hits top prize, the money rolls down to the next tier. Just remember: MyLotto will be offline after Saturday’s draw for upgrades, back online Sunday morning as the new game kicks off with a fresh five million starting jackpot.
